摘要
[目的/意义]为解决应急情境下决策情报需求难以快速、准确识别的问题,提出基于领域分析和本体的应急决策情报需求的识别方法。[方法/过程]首先,构建了应急情报需求分析模型,细化为"任务情境-情报需求"模板,并构建相应的概念本体;然后,利用该模型对应急领域进行专家或大数据领域需求分析,获取应急情报需求知识,并利用本体进行实例化描述,形成应急情报需求本体知识库;最后,利用该知识库实现应急情报需求的智能推荐。[结果/结论]基于领域分析的用户应急情报需求获取的本质是社会认知启发下的个人认知,弥补了个人知识、能力不足引起的个人认知缺陷,是"平时"获取的领域知识在"战时"的应用;而领域情报需求的本体化表示是语义级的,可实现用户应急决策情报需求的智能推荐,以适应应急决策情报快速响应的要求。
        [Objective/Significance]In order to solve the problem of quick and accurate identification of decision-making intelligence in emergency situations,this paper proposes an intelligent identification method for emergency decision intelligence needs based on domain analysis and ontology.[Method/Process]First,an emergency intelligence need analysis model is constructed,which is refined into the template of " task context-intelligence demand",and the corresponding conceptual ontology is constructed. Then,the model is used to analyze the emergency domain needs by expert or by big data,to obtain the knowledge of the emergency intelligence needs,and the ontology is used for the instantiation description,so as to form the ontology-based knowledge base of the emergency intelligence needs. Finally,the knowledge base is used to realize intelligent recommendation of emergency intelligence needs.[Results/Conclusion]The essence of users' emergency intelligence needs acquisition based on domain analysis is personal cognition inspired by social cognition,which makes up for personal cognitive defects caused by insufficient personal knowledge and ability,and is the application in " wartime" of domain knowledge acquired in " peacetime". The ontological representation of domain intelligence needs is semantic,which can realize the intelligent recommendation of users' emergency decision-making intelligence needs,so as to meet the requirement of quick response of emergency decision-making intelligence.
